Resumo
The present article is an attempt to understand the multiple phenomena that characterized the post-war period and the dynamics and forces that have led, since the 1970s, to the deep transformations that all of us have been undergoing. In the first section, we address the main aspects that delimited the advent of modernity and the consolidation of the capitalist world-system, emphasizing the great economic changes at the end of the 19th century and beginning of the 20th century, as well as the decades of crisis in the first half of the past century. In the following four sections, the analysis focuses critically on the most important events throughout the trajectory of the global economy, from the post-war period to the present (the beginning of the second decade of the 21st century). We conclude with an assessment of contemporaneity, trying to emphasize the dilemmas that humanity will have to face ahead.
